Overview
Explore the theorem of Inclusion/Exclusion in Set Theory through an unorthodox lens focusing on multisets rather than traditional sets in this 48-minute video lecture. Delve into a unique approach that reduces the theorem to its arithmetic counterpart and apply it to the Euler phi function. Expand your understanding of multisets to include integral_msets, where element multiplicities can be any integer, not just natural numbers or zero. Discover how this broader perspective allows for differences between multisets, providing the flexibility needed for a conceptual and general statement of the Inclusion/Exclusion theorem. Learn about multiset operations such as sums, unions, intersections, and differences, and gain insights into the modern interpretation of negative numbers in counting exercises.
